What is the name of Lahinch's airport?
Shannon Airport (SNN) is the sole airport serving Lahinch.
How far is Shannon Airport (SNN) from central Lahinch?
Shannon Airport is 40 kilometers from downtown Lahinch, so prepare yourself for a reasonable commute into the city center.

How long is the flight to Lahinch Airport?
Which city you depart from determines how long you’ll be strapped into your seat. From London to Lahinch, the average flight time is 1 hour and 27 minutes. From Boston it takes about 5 hours and 55 minutes, and from New York it’s 6 hours and 5 minutes.

Do not pack the following items in your hand luggage:

  • While the list of restricted items differs between airlines, the general rule to follow is avoid carrying anything sharp, flammable or explosive. This includes screwdrivers, drills, fireworks and fuel. Sports equipment like baseball bats, and objects that could harm passengers, such as pepper spray and firearms, can’t come on board with you either.

What to wear on a flight:

  • Comfort should be your number one priority when selecting what to wear during your flight. Consider your footwear with care too, as swollen ankles and feet can be a side effect of flying. Flat shoes which are slightly roomy work well.
  • Most travelers have heard about deep vein thrombosis (DVT), a blood clotting condition caused by prolonged periods of sitting. There are many ways to lower your risk. Don a pair of compression socks, drink lots of water often and remember to keep your legs and feet moving. Do a lap or two of the cabin or try out some simple stretches in your seat.

How to get through airport security fast when flying to Lahinch?
It’s all about being organized. We’ve compiled some useful tips for a stress-free trip through security. Watch out Lahinch, here you come:

  • Your boarding pass and passport will need to be inspected by airport security. Keep them within easy reach to avoid fumbling around for them.
  • Time to strip down. Well kind of. Your jacket, belt, keys and other small items, like your headphones, will be required to go through the X-ray machine. Make the whole process easier by removing them before your turn arrives.
  • All electronic gadgets, including your laptop and phone, must also be scanned separately.
  • Any liquids or gels, such as perfume or hand cream, that you want to bring on board must be no larger than 3.4 ounces (100 milliliters). They must also all fit inside a quart-size (one liter), clear zip-close bag.
  • Slip-on shoes are a clever footwear choice as you’re less likely to be required to remove them when passing through security. Safety boots and heavier-style shoes are usually subjected to additional screening.
  • Pocket knives and other sharp items can’t be taken on board. They’ll be confiscated at security, so pack them safely away in your checked suitcase.
